Perform a Clean Boot

Perform a Clean Boot Thumbnail
Difficulty
Intermediate
Steps
13
Time Required
10 minutes
Sections
7
Description

In this guide, we will demonstrate how to perform a clean boot. A clean boot can repair ephoto826.exe problems.

Step 1: Press Windows + R keys

Step 1: Press Windows + R keys Thumbnail
  1. This opens the Run dialog box.

Step 2: Open System Configuration

Step 2: Open System Configuration Thumbnail
  1. Type msconfig and press Enter.

Step 3: Select Selective Startup

Step 3: Select Selective Startup Thumbnail
  1. In the General tab, select Selective startup.

  2. Uncheck Load startup items.

Step 4: Disable All Microsoft Services

Step 4: Disable All Microsoft Services Thumbnail
  1. Go to the Services tab.

  2. Check Hide all Microsoft services.

  3. Click Disable all.

Step 5: Disable Startup Programs

Step 5: Disable Startup Programs Thumbnail
  1. Open Task Manager.

  2. Go to the Startup tab.

  3. Disable all the startup programs.

Step 6: Restart Your Computer

Step 6: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. Click OK on the System Configuration window.

  2. Restart your computer.

Step 7: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 7: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the computer restarts, check if the ephoto826.exe problem persists.

Perform a System Restore to Fix Exe Errors

Perform a System Restore to Fix Exe Errors Thumbnail
Difficulty
Advanced
Steps
9
Time Required
20 minutes
Sections
5
Description

How to perform a System Restore to repair ephoto826.exe issues.

Step 1: Open System Restore

Step 1: Open System Restore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type System Restore in the search bar and press Enter.

  3. Click on Create a restore point.

Step 2: Choose a Restore Point

Step 2: Choose a Restore Point Thumbnail
  1. In the System Properties window, under the System Protection tab, click on System Restore....

  2. Click Next in the System Restore window.

  3. Choose a restore point from the list. Ideally, select a point when you know the system was working well.

Step 3: Start the Restore Process

Step 3: Start the Restore Process Thumbnail
  1. Click Next, then Finish to start the restore process.

Step 4: Restart Your Computer

Step 4: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. Once the restore process is complete, restart your computer.

Step 5: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 5: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the restart, check if the ephoto826.exe problem persists.
